服务器负载均衡如何处理,深入解析服务器负载均衡,原理、方法及实际应用
- 综合资讯
- 2025-04-04 05:20:14
- 2

服务器负载均衡通过分配请求至多台服务器,实现高效资源利用和系统稳定性,其原理涉及流量分发策略,如轮询、最少连接等,方法包括硬件和软件负载均衡器,实际应用涵盖网站、数据库...
服务器负载均衡通过分配请求至多台服务器,实现高效资源利用和系统稳定性,其原理涉及流量分发策略,如轮询、最少连接等,方法包括硬件和软件负载均衡器,实际应用涵盖网站、数据库、游戏服务器等场景,确保服务质量和用户体验。
随着互联网的快速发展,企业对信息技术的需求日益增长,服务器作为企业信息系统的核心组成部分,其稳定性和性能至关重要,随着业务量的不断增长,单一服务器往往难以满足日益增长的访问需求,为了提高服务器性能,降低单点故障风险,服务器负载均衡技术应运而生,本文将深入解析服务器负载均衡的原理、方法及实际应用。
服务器负载均衡的原理
服务器负载均衡(Server Load Balancing,简称SLB)是一种将多个服务器资源虚拟化,通过算法将用户请求分发到各个服务器上,从而实现负载均衡的技术,其核心原理如下:
图片来源于网络,如有侵权联系删除
-
负载均衡器:负载均衡器是服务器负载均衡系统的核心组件,负责接收用户请求,并根据预设的算法将请求分发到后端服务器。
-
负载均衡算法:负载均衡算法是决定请求分发策略的关键因素,常见的算法有轮询、最少连接、IP哈希等。
-
后端服务器:后端服务器是实际处理用户请求的服务器,负载均衡器将请求分发到后端服务器,由其完成业务处理。
-
监控机制:监控机制负责实时监控后端服务器的运行状态,如CPU、内存、网络等,当服务器出现异常时,负载均衡器将停止向该服务器分发请求。
服务器负载均衡的方法
根据负载均衡器的实现方式,服务器负载均衡方法主要分为以下几种:
-
软件负载均衡:软件负载均衡是通过在服务器上安装负载均衡软件来实现,如Nginx、HAProxy等,软件负载均衡具有成本低、配置灵活等优点,但性能相对较低。
-
硬件负载均衡:硬件负载均衡是通过专用设备来实现,如F5 BIG-IP、Citrix NetScaler等,硬件负载均衡具有高性能、高可靠性等优点,但成本较高。
-
云负载均衡:云负载均衡是利用云计算平台提供的负载均衡服务来实现,如阿里云SLB、腾讯云CLB等,云负载均衡具有弹性伸缩、易于管理等优点,但存在一定的依赖性。
图片来源于网络,如有侵权联系删除
服务器负载均衡的实际应用
服务器负载均衡在实际应用中具有广泛的应用场景,以下列举几个典型应用:
-
网站负载均衡:网站负载均衡可以将大量用户请求分发到多个服务器,提高网站访问速度和稳定性,如电商平台、门户网站等。
-
应用服务器负载均衡:应用服务器负载均衡可以将业务请求分发到多个应用服务器,提高应用性能和可靠性,如企业内部系统、在线教育平台等。
-
数据库负载均衡:数据库负载均衡可以将查询请求分发到多个数据库服务器,提高数据库访问速度和可靠性,如大型企业级应用、电商平台等。
-
流媒体负载均衡:流媒体负载均衡可以将视频、音频等流媒体请求分发到多个服务器,提高流媒体播放的稳定性和流畅性,如在线视频网站、直播平台等。
服务器负载均衡是一种提高服务器性能、降低单点故障风险的重要技术,通过深入解析服务器负载均衡的原理、方法及实际应用,有助于企业更好地理解和应用该技术,从而提高信息系统的高可用性和稳定性,在互联网时代,服务器负载均衡技术将继续发挥重要作用。
本文链接:https://www.zhitaoyun.cn/1996661.html
发表评论